验证.csv文件中是否包含所有值可以通过以下步骤进行:
csv
库,来读取.csv文件的内容。以下是一个示例的Python代码,演示了如何验证.csv文件中是否包含所有值:
import csv
# 读取.csv文件
def read_csv_file(file_path):
with open(file_path, 'r') as file:
reader = csv.reader(file)
data = list(reader)
return data
# 验证.csv文件中是否包含所有值
def validate_csv_values(file_path, expected_values):
data = read_csv_file(file_path)
found_values = []
for row in data:
for value in row:
if value in expected_values:
found_values.append(value)
missing_values = set(expected_values) - set(found_values)
if len(missing_values) == 0:
print("验证通过,.csv文件中包含所有值。")
else:
print("验证未通过,.csv文件中缺少以下值:")
for value in missing_values:
print(value)
# 示例使用
file_path = 'example.csv'
expected_values = ['value1', 'value2', 'value3']
validate_csv_values(file_path, expected_values)
请注意,以上代码仅为示例,实际应用中可能需要根据具体情况进行适当的修改和优化。
推荐的腾讯云相关产品:腾讯云对象存储(COS),用于存储和管理.csv文件等各种文件类型。产品介绍链接地址:https://cloud.tencent.com/product/cos
领取专属 10元无门槛券
手把手带您无忧上云